According to John Hick (1982), the story of religion is one in which the divine gradually has been more and more fully revealed. In his perspective on the history of religion, the early period of religious life was incomplete, with tribal gods and goddesses who were more human projection than divine revelation.
For him, that changed when the world religions were born during the axial period and beyond. Karl Jaspers defined the axial period, or axial age, as that time from approximately 800 B.C.E. To 200 B.C.E. When the first world religions were born that stemmed primarily from individual revelatory experiences."
